Python中字典和集合映射类型:表示一个任意对象的集合,且可以通过另一个几乎是任意键值的集合进行索引与序列不同,映射是无序的,通过键进行索引任何不可变对象都可用作字典的键,如字符串、数字、元组等包含可变对象的列表、字典和元组不能用作键引用不存在的键会引发KeyError异常1)字典dict { } 空字典{ key1:value1,key2:value2,... }字典在其它编程语言中又称作关联
转载
2023-11-03 19:41:56
48阅读
## Python 字典数据库
在日常编程中,我们经常需要存储和检索大量的数据。为了高效地管理数据,我们可以使用数据库。数据库是一种结构化的数据集合,可以方便地存储、访问和管理数据。在 Python 中,字典(Dictionary)可以作为一种简单的数据库来使用。本文将介绍如何使用字典来实现简单的数据库功能,并通过代码示例详细讲解。
### 字典简介
在 Python 中,字典是一种无序的数
原创
2023-12-04 15:25:32
57阅读
# 创建一个 Python 语文字典库的完整指南
## 1. 项目概述
在这个指南中,我们将创建一个简单的 Python 语文字典库,帮助用户存储和管理单词及其定义。这个项目将涉及基本的文件操作、数据结构使用以及简单的可视化展示。
## 2. 项目流程
以下是实现这个项目的步骤:
| 步骤 | 描述 |
| ----
Python3 字典字典是另一种可变容器模型,且可存储任意类型对象。字典的每个键值(key=>value)对用冒号(:)分割,每个对之间用逗号(,)分割,整个字典包括在花括号({})中 ,格式如下所示:d = {key1 : value1, key2 : value2 }键必须是唯一的,但值则不必。值可以取任何数据类型,但键必须是不可变的,如字符串,数字或元组。一个简单的字典实例:dict
转载
2024-01-02 12:36:14
39阅读
读取字典中特定键所对应的值 第一种方法,直接读取D={"键1":"值1","key2":"value2"}
v=D["key2"] # 没有这个键会报错
print(v) 第二种方法,利用字典的get()函数D={"键1":"值1","key2":"value2"}
a=D.get("键12") # 没有这个键时或返回: None
print(a) 根据字典中的值查询键D={"键1":"值1"
转载
2023-07-05 14:39:47
74阅读
# 实现Python字典写入数据库的步骤
## 整体流程
首先,让我们来看一下实现Python字典写入数据库的整体流程。下面是一个简单的表格展示了这个流程。
| 步骤 | 描述 |
|------|------------------------|
| 1 | 连接数据库 |
| 2 | 创建数据库表
原创
2024-04-18 04:22:16
105阅读
# Python字典写入数据库的步骤
## 引言
作为一名经验丰富的开发者,我很高兴能够分享如何将Python字典写入数据库的方法给刚入行的小白。在本文中,我将向你展示整个过程的流程,并提供每个步骤所需的代码和相应的注释。让我们开始吧!
## 整体流程
在将Python字典写入数据库的过程中,我们需要完成以下几个步骤:
1. 连接到数据库:首先,我们需要建立与数据库的连接。
2. 创建表
原创
2023-12-12 03:48:25
143阅读
# Python字典入数据库的实现方法
## 概述
在Python中,将字典数据存储到数据库中是一项常见的任务。本文将介绍如何使用Python代码实现字典入数据库的过程,包括建立数据库连接、创建表格、插入数据等步骤。同时,为了更好地理解每一步的操作,我们将以表格和代码注释的形式进行展示和说明。
在本文中,我们将使用MySQL数据库作为示例,但同样的思路和方法也适用于其他类型的数据库。
##
原创
2024-01-24 11:40:56
121阅读
文章目录定义操作访问及修改长度len()查找及删除字符串格式化输出字典的函数copy和deepcopyclear清除get和setdefultget()setdefault()items, keys, valuespop和popitemupdate 字典是另一种可变容器模型,且可存储任意类型对象。 定义字典的每个键值(key=>value)对用冒号(:)分割,每个对之间用逗号(,)分割
转载
2024-09-30 07:52:22
37阅读
Python在设计上坚持了清晰划一的风格,这使得Python成为一门易读、易维护,并且被大量用户所欢迎的、用途广泛的语言。今天小编帮大家简单介绍下Python的一种数据结构: 字典,字典是 Python 提供的一种常用的数据结构,它用于存放具有映射关系的数据。比如有份成绩表数据,语文:79,数学:80,英语:92,这组数据看上去像两个列表,但这两个列表的元素之间有一定的关联关系。如果单纯使用两个列
转载
2023-08-31 14:14:34
155阅读
一、字典的初始1、之前已经学习的容器型数据类型只有list,那么list够用么?他有什么缺点呢? a、列表可以储存大量的数据类型,但是如果数据量太大的话,他的查询速度比较慢 b、列表只能按照顺序存储,数据与数据之间关联性不强。针对与以上缺点,需要引入另外一种容器型数据类型,解决上面的问题,这就是dict字典2、数据类型可以按照不同的角度进行分类,这里按照可变与不可变数据类型分类 不可变(可哈
转载
2023-06-21 16:03:22
197阅读
一、题目及引入[制作外文字典](第十周实验)词典有3个基本功能:添加,查询和退出。程序读取源文件路径下的“我的词典.txt”文件,若没有就创建一个。程序根据用户的选择进入相应的模块,并显示相应的操作提示。当添加的单词已经存在时,把新输入的中文作为新的释义(即允许多重释义)。当查询的单词不存在时,要提示“词典库没有该单词”。用户输入其它选项,提示“输入错误” 编写时需注意的四个小问题:①每
转载
2023-09-06 13:26:39
43阅读
**字典:**- [ ] 列表可以存储大量的数据,但是如果数据量大的话,他的查询速度比较慢,因为列表只能顺序存储,数据与数据之间的关联性不强。所以便有了字典(dict)这种容器的数据类型,它是以{}括起来的。> 语法:{‘key1’ :1,‘key2’:2}其中 key :必须是可哈希的数据类型,例如:int,bool,str,tuple。不可哈希的有:list dict set(集合),而
转载
2023-11-09 09:47:21
137阅读
字典定义:每个键值 key:value 对用冒号 : 分割,每个键值对之间用逗号,分割,整个字典包括在花括号 {} 中 ,格式如下所示:d = {key1 : value1, key2 : value2 }一、创建字典的几种方法总结(1)创建空字典 dic = {}
type(dic)
# <type 'dict'>
转载
2023-09-18 19:36:46
150阅读
## 实现Java字典库的流程
为了实现Java字典库,我们可以按照以下步骤进行操作:
1. 创建字典类
2. 添加键值对
3. 获取键值对
4. 修改键值对
5. 删除键值对
6. 查询键值对
下面我们将逐步介绍每个步骤需要做什么,并提供相应的代码示例。
### 1. 创建字典类
首先,我们需要创建一个字典类,用于存储键值对。这个类可以使用HashMap或者LinkedHashMap实
原创
2023-12-11 08:13:50
30阅读
# Java 字典库
Java 字典库是一个常用的数据结构,用于存储键值对的集合。在Java中,字典库通常指的是HashMap类,它实现了基于哈希表的Map接口,提供了快速的插入、删除、查找操作。
## HashMap 类
HashMap类是Java中最常用的字典库实现之一,它允许null键和值,并且是非同步的,因此在多线程环境下需要使用Collections.synchronizedMap
原创
2024-06-13 06:10:41
8阅读
# 如何创建MySQL字典库
## 1. 整体流程
首先,我们需要了解整个创建MySQL字典库的流程。下面是创建MySQL字典库的步骤:
```mermaid
flowchart TD
A[连接MySQL数据库] --> B[创建数据库]
B --> C[创建表格]
C --> D[插入数据]
D --> E[查询数据]
```
## 2. 具体步骤
##
原创
2024-06-23 05:01:30
34阅读
Python字典是另一种可变容器模型(无序),且可存储任意类型对象,如字符串、数字、元组等其他容器模型。本文章主要介绍Python中字典(Dict)的详解操作方法,包含创建、访问、删除、其它操作等,需要的朋友可以参考下。字典由键和对应值成对组成。字典也被称作关联数组或哈希表。基本语法如下:1.创建字典1 >>> dict = {'ob1':'computer', 'ob2':'m
转载
2023-12-04 18:58:07
65阅读
Python还被大家称为“胶水语言”,它适用于网站、桌面应用开发、自动化脚本、复杂计算系统、科学计算、生命支持管理系统、物联网、游戏、机器人、自然语言处理等很多方面。对于职场人来说,Python可以帮助他们实现自动化办公提高工作效率。 而对于很多学生来说,Python可以帮助他们爬取各种资料。Python也是拥有的最热门的技能之一,并且根据“编程语言索引的流行度”,它也是世界上最受欢迎
转载
2023-08-22 11:00:02
68阅读
此代码实现将dict写入mysql指定表中。 如果指定表不存在,则根据dict中key的字段创建表,然后将dict写入表中import pymysql
from scrapy.conf import settings
class DataToMysql:
def __init__(self, host, user, passwd, db, port):
try:
转载
2023-05-27 16:10:10
352阅读